Teenage Malaysian rapper Bunga stands out from her contemporaries in the hip-hop scene – she performs wearing the traditional Malay attire of hijab and baju kurung.
“I want this to be my identity. I want people to see me in a baju kurung and go, ‘Oh yeah, that’s Bunga.’ I think it’s good for both the youth and for the culture,” the 19-year-old, whose real name is Noor Ayu Fatini Mohd Bakhari, says in a telephone interview from Universiti Teknologi MARA in Negeri Sembilan, where she is studying public administration.
